Cellardoor, how is Rennes-le-Château in the game in comparison to real life? Exact copy? Similar? Different?

Well, for starters, the real RLC isn't as quiet as in GK since it's filled with tourists. The church interior is an almost perfect match. The roof of the Magdalen Tower is also as it appears in the game - though it is connected with the musuem at ground level.

http://www.renneslechateau.com/photos/format/0138.jpg

The bookstore wasn't closed when I visited and I even bought a book (Holy Blood and the Holy Grail) there. Also, I bought a bottle of "Berenger Saunière Wine" at a local café, which I'm saving for a special occasion. :)

Basically, the RLC in GK3 isn't a perfect copy for the most part, but the artists really managed to capture the character and atmosphere of the small French village. I can recommend a visit to all of you who enjoyed GK3.
